Transaction 3ac90839b9a006e109dbf914f72efd565062fff50e64ece25efac14c9bc3807c

2 Input
2 Outputs
  • 3ac90839b9a006e109dbf914f72efd565062fff50e64ece25efac14c9bc3807c:0
  • value  509974501
    address  19duDs8rX1QvUCEg5w9XvuCqtUM9S7v7ih
  • 3ac90839b9a006e109dbf914f72efd565062fff50e64ece25efac14c9bc3807c:1
  • value  9815499
    address  1CM8EmNN1CYyw5aSzYJu4FPmrCDzE7eH6q